How do I add text to a face in Freecad?
Ok, here’s what works: select your work plane first.
- Select the face.
- Click on the Set working plane button in the Draft toolbar.
- Click on the Draft ShapeString icon.
- Pick a point on the face.
- Enter text and parameters as explained in the wiki.

What is FreeCAD draft?
Draft Workbench is primarily focused on the creation and modification of 2D objects in FreeCAD. But it is not restricted to the XY plane of the global coordinate system. Its objects can have any orientation and position in 3D space, and some Draft objects can either be planar or non-planar.

Is there a free 2D CAD program?
QCAD is a free, open source application for computer aided drafting (CAD) in two dimensions (2D). With QCAD you can create technical drawings such as plans for buildings, interiors, mechanical parts or schematics and diagrams. QCAD works on Windows, macOS and Linux.

What is reverse engraving?
Reverse engraving refers to the process of engraving the “under-side” of a substrate – allowing the top or finished side of the substrate to remain smooth. The process of reverse engraving is very similar to traditional first. surface (top) engraving.

How do I turn on FreeCAD grid?
To use the grid select: Edit → Preferences… → Draft → Grid and snapping → Grid → Use grid. After changing this preference you must restart FreeCAD. Several other grid preferences are also available: Edit → Preferences…
How do I change the grid on FreeCAD?
So, to change the grid size go to Edit > Preferences > Draft > Snapping settings and change the value for “Grid spacing”.

What is the difference between Debossing and embossing?
Embossing involves creating a three-dimensional raised-up image or design, while debossed materials have the required design pressed into them, so that the resulting image is indented below the surface.
